Functions Under City Manager 36 <br /> Total 100 <br /> <br />As you will note, the percentages <br />the range of percentage of General <br />three categories. <br /> <br />in Alternative No. 2 are in <br />Fund expenditures for these <br /> <br />The following comments are offered with respect to the proposed <br />cuts under both alternatives for those functions under the <br />jurisdiction of the City Manager. <br /> <br />ALTERNATIVE NO. 1 <br /> <br />Transportation Allowance: Travel allowances for <br />commission members to attend meetings were included for <br />two commissions (not three) as previously stated, <br />therefore, $1,400 can be cut. <br /> <br />Fire Truck: Under our budget proposal $48,031 included <br />in the current budget would be carried over <br />(reappropriated) with an additional $51,969 to be <br />appropriated in FY86-87, bringing the total funds <br />available for replacing the ladder truck to $100,000. <br />This would enable the City to obtain this equipment on <br />a three (3) year lease purchase arrangement. <br /> <br />This alternative reduces the appropriation by $30,000 <br />leaving $70,000 which would still permit purchase of <br />the equipment but under a five (5) year lease purchase <br />agreement. <br /> <br />Air Condition Jail: The State has appropriated <br />matching funds to match the $21,000 that is included in <br />the proposed budget. However, in consideration of our <br />budget concerns this can be cut and perhaps installed <br />at some later date. <br />
